6 Below: Miracle on the Mountain

6 Below: Miracle on the Mountain (2017)

October. 13,2017
|
5.7
|
PG-13
| Drama Thriller

An adrenaline seeking snowboarder gets lost in a massive winter storm in the back country of the High Sierras where he is pushed to the limits of human endurance and forced to battle his own personal demons as he fights for survival....
